The filter plate of a pressure filter is one of its core components, primarily used for filtering in the solid-liquid separation process. It retains solid particles from the suspension on the filter cloth by pressure, forming a filter cake, while the liquid passes through the filter plate. The material, structure, and working principle of the filter plate directly affect the filtration efficiency and service life of the pressure filter.
Material: Common filter plate materials include glass fiber reinforced plastic, cast iron, and stainless steel. Glass fiber reinforced plastic filter plates are lightweight and corrosion-resistant, suitable for chemical, environmental protection, and other industries; cast iron filter plates are high in strength and pressure resistance, ideal for high-pressure conditions; stainless steel filter plates have strong corrosion resistance, suitable for food and pharmaceutical industries.
Working Principle: During operation, the filter plates are clamped tightly under the action of the hydraulic system, forming a sealed filter chamber. The suspension fluid enters the filter chamber through the feed opening and, under pressure, the liquid passes through the filter cloth and plates while the solid particles are retained inside the chamber to form a filter cake. Once the filter cake reaches a certain thickness, the press filter stops feeding, the filter plates are released, and the filter cake is discharged.
Application Scenes: Press filter plates are widely used in industries such as petrochemicals, environmental protection, metallurgy, food, and medicine, for processing various suspensions, such as sludge dewatering, mineral concentration, and chemical product filtration.
Important Notes:
Ensure the filter plate is installed flat to avoid cracking due to uneven stress.
2. Select filter cloth based on the properties of the filtering material to prevent clogging or damage.
3. Regularly inspect the filter plate's sealing to prevent leakage or insufficient pressure from affecting filtration performance.
Operation Steps:
Preparation: Check if the filter plates and filter cloth are intact, and if the hydraulic system is functioning properly.
2. Pressurized Filter Plate: Activate the hydraulic system to press the filter plate to the working pressure (usually 0.6 MPa).
3. Material Feed Filtration: Open the feed valve, and the suspension enters the filter chamber. It is recommended to control the filtration pressure to 0.8 MPa or less.
4. Unloading: After filtration, loosen the filter plate and remove the filter cake.
5. Cleaning & Maintenance: Clean filter fabrics and plates, inspect equipment status, ensure normal operation for next use.
